How to Reach Tepusteca in Honduras

Tepusteca is a beautiful destination located in the western region of Honduras. It is known for its stunning landscapes, rich cultural heritage, and warm hospitality. If you are planning to visit Tepusteca, here are a few ways to reach this enchanting place:

1. By Air:

The easiest way to reach Tepusteca is by flying into Ramón Villeda Morales International Airport in San Pedro Sula, which is the closest major airport to the region.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to travel to Tepusteca. The journey takes approximately 2 hours, offering picturesque views of the Honduran countryside along the way.

2. By Road:

If you prefer a more adventurous route, you can reach Tepusteca by road. The region is well-connected by a network of highways, making it accessible from various cities in Honduras. From San Pedro Sula, you can take the CA-5 highway towards Santa Rosa de Copán. Once you reach Santa Rosa de Copán, continue on the CA-11 highway until you reach Tepusteca. The road journey offers a chance to explore the scenic beauty of Honduras and its charming towns.

3. By Public Transportation:

If you are looking for a budget-friendly option, you can reach Tepusteca by public transportation. From San Pedro Sula, you can take a bus or a shared taxi to Santa Rosa de Copán. Once you reach Santa Rosa de Copán, you can find local buses or taxis that will take you to Tepusteca. Although it may take longer compared to other modes of transportation, it allows you to immerse yourself in the local culture and interact with friendly locals.

Getting to know Tepusteca

Tepusteca is a small village located in the western region of Honduras. Situated amidst lush green mountains and picturesque landscapes, this charming village offers a tranquil and serene environment for its residents and visitors. The village is known for its rich cultural heritage and warm hospitality, making it a popular destination for tourists seeking an authentic Honduran experience.

One of the main attractions of Tepusteca is its stunning natural beauty. The village is surrounded by dense forests and pristine waterfalls, making it an ideal destination for nature lovers and adventure enthusiasts. Visitors can explore the numerous hiking trails that wind through the mountains, offering bre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side. The village is also home to several natural hot springs, known for their therapeutic properties, where visitors can relax and rejuvenate.

In addition to its natural wonders, Tepusteca is also known for its vibrant cultural scene. The village hosts regular festivals and events that showcase the traditional music, dance, and cuisine of Honduras. Visitors can immerse themselves in the lively atmosphere and experience the rich cultural heritage of the local community. The village is also home to several craft markets, where visitors can purchase handmade souvenirs and traditional artwork.

Tepusteca is a hidden gem in Honduras, offering a unique blend of natural beauty and cultural richness. Whether you are seeking adventure, relaxation, or a glimpse into the vibrant Honduran culture, this charming village has something to offer for everyone.
